Allegro Microsystems' A8591 provides all the control and protection circuitry to produce a fixed 5 V or 3.3 V output, 2 A regulator with ±1% output voltage accuracy. The A8591 employs pulse-frequency modulation (PFM) to draw less than 33 μA from 12 VIN while supplying 5 V/40 μA, making it ideal for automotive battery powered "keepalive" applications. The sleep feature drops standby current down to 5 μA.
When operational, the A8591 operates down to at least 3.6 VIN (VIN falling). The regulator's PWM switching frequency can be programmed with a resistor or synchronized to an external clock. The A8591 has external compensation to optimize stability and transient response for a wide range of external components and applications. The A8591 has a fixed soft-start time of 5 ms.
The A8591 is targeted for the automotive market in the following applications: instrument clusters, audio systems, navigation, HUD, ADAS, and HVAC.
The A8591 is supplied in a 10-pin wettable flank DFN package (suffix EJ) with exposed power pad. It is lead (Pb) free with 100% matte-tin leadframe plating.
Features and Benefits
- Automotive AEC-Q100 qualified
- Withstands surge input to 40 VIN for load dump
- Operates down to 3.4 VIN (typ.), 3.6 VIN (max.) for idle stop
- Utilizes pulse-frequency modulation (PFM) for low-IQ mode
- 10 μA sleep mode (automatic PWM/low-IQ PFM mode selection)
- Fixed output voltage options: 3.3 V or 5 V with ±1% accuracy
- Delivers up to 2 A of output current
- Integrated 110 mΩ high-side MOSFET
- Adjustable switching frequency from 300 kHz to 2.4 MHz
- EMI reduction features:
- Frequency dithering
- Controlled switching node
- External synchronization capability
- Maximum duty cycle for low dropout
- Active low NPOR output with 7.5 ms delay
- Pre-bias startup capable: VOUT increases monotonically, will not cause a reset
- External compensation for max. flexibility
- Stable with ceramic or electrolytic output capacitors
- Internally fixed soft-start time of 5 ms
- Pulse-by-pulse current limit, hiccup mode short-circuit, and thermal protections
- Pin open/short and component fault tolerant
- -40°C to +150°C operating junction temperature range
- Thermally enhanced DFN-10 surface-mount package
